LeRoy Sanderson Obituary

LeRoy Laster Sanderson

LeRoy Laster Sanderson passed away in Holdenville, OK on Thursday, July 28, 2022, at the age of 84.

LeRoy was born September 15, 1937 in Tulsa, OK to the late Raymond and Letha Sanderson. He married his wife, Mary (Renken) Sanderson on June 20, 1964 and spent 52 years together.

LeRoy grew up in Tulsa and graduated from Will Rogers High School. He attended Oklahoma State University and Tulsa University for a year before joining the United States Air Force in 1957. He was trained as a jet engine mechanic for F-100 and F-104 airplanes while stationed in Pensacola, FL and Fukuoka, JP. While stationed in Japan, LeRoy made lifelong friends and he returned to visit his friends many times. After the Air Force, LeRoy worked for Skelly Oil, Getty Oil, and finally Texaco Oil in Tulsa, OK, as a bookkeeper for 23 years before relocating his family to Wewoka, OK to work for his cousin, Ferril Williamson, at Williamson Investment Company, where he was employed until his retirement.

A talented hobbyist mechanic, LeRoy enjoyed restoring and painting cars and airplanes. He and his father began a business, Chevy Sales, and enjoyed working on cars together on the weekends. LeRoy loved to travel and took his family to most of the 50 states, Mexico, and Japan. LeRoy received his pilot's license in March 1972 and enjoyed flying his family to a variety of locations for many of the family vacations. LeRoy enjoyed spending his retirement working outdoors on his farm with many cows, dogs, and cats, and riding his bulldozer and tractor. LeRoy was a proud member of of the Masons and local Lions Club and served one term as Mayor of Wewoka.
